Prominent Georgia Republican Activist Alec Poitevint Endorses Marco

Today, former Georgia Republican Party Chairman and former Republican National Committee (RNC) National Committeeman Alec Poitevint endorsed Marco Rubio for president.

Poitevint is a leading GOP activist in Georgia, where he served as Chairman of Governor Sonny Perdue's 2002 gubernatorial campaign and Chairman of Senator David Perdue's 2014 Senate campaign. In addition to being a RNC Committeeman, Poitevint has also served on the national stage as Chairman of the Committee on Arrangements at the 2012 Republican National Convention and the Co-Chairman and Treasurer of the 2000 Republican National Convention. He is the President and Chairman of Southeastern Minerals, Inc. in Georgia. 

"Having endured almost eight years of President Obama, Americans are frustrated with the direction of our country. I am one of them. The only way to turn it around and advance our conservative cause is to win in November," said Alec Poitevint. "I believe the only candidate who can do that is Marco Rubio. His conservative values are second to none.”
